Output dffc17e112eaa6d6e52cb2c907a52867d11effefb3d6d617dd11d83831079aca:1

value
2870223
script pubkey
OP_0 OP_PUSHBYTES_20 1b8b615b188f5a71a4161a663db1b531c505f609
address
bc1qrw9kzkcc3ad8rfqkrfnrmvd4x8zstasfmt4n8f
transaction
dffc17e112eaa6d6e52cb2c907a52867d11effefb3d6d617dd11d83831079aca
confirmations
175721
spent
true